Explore the Yungas rainforest and the Campo Alegre Dam on a birdwatching experience with a specialized guide. Over 200 possible species in a unique natural environment in northern Argentina.
Discover the extraordinary diversity of birds in northern Argentina on this half-day trip from Salta to La Caldera and the Ruta de la Cornisa (RN9).

Surrounded by the mountains and lush vegetation of the Yungas, we'll explore the Campo Alegre Dam and its surroundings, one of the best birdwatching spots in the region.

Salta is the province with the greatest bird diversity in Argentina, with over 660 registered species. This tour combines aquatic environments and mountain forest, offering excellent photographic and observation opportunities.
